Facts about
- 30th April is known as National Raisin Day.
- Fresno, California is known as raisin capital of the world.
- Half of world's raisin supply is produced in California.
- Apples can be as small as a pea and as big as a pumpkin.
- There are more than 8000 varieties of apples.
- Life of an Apple tree can be more than 100 years.
- Apples contain 25% air, therefore they float in water.

Difference Between Raisin and Green apple
We might think that Raisin and Green apple are similar with respect to nutritional value and health benefits. But the nutrient content of both fruits is different. Raisin and Green apple Facts such as their taste, shape, color, and size are also distinct. The difference between Raisin and Green apple is explained here.
The amount of calories in 100 gm of fresh Raisin and Green apple with peel is 299.00 kcal and 52.00 kcal and the amount of calories without peel is Not Available and 48.00 kcal respectively. Thus, Raisin and Green apple belong to High Calorie Fruits and Low Calorie Fruits category.These fruits might or might not differ with respect to their scientific classification. The order of Raisin and Green apple is Vitales and Rosales respectively. Raisin belongs to Vitaceae family and Green apple belongs to Rosaceae family. Raisin belongs to Vitis genus of Vitis vinifera species and Green apple belongs to Malus genus of M. domestica species. Beings plants, both fruits belong to Plantae Kingdom.
